Safety Measures and Best Practices When Using Shackles for Truck Recovery
When utilizing shackles for truck recovery in Brownsville, Texas, safety should always be the top priority for fleet managers and drivers alike. Proper training is crucial to ensure that everyone involved understands the best practices for using this critical recovery equipment. Before attempting any recovery operation, a thorough inspection of the shackles is essential to confirm their integrity and functionality. Look for signs of wear, corrosion, or damage, as these can compromise the security of the load during transport.
Best practices include securing loads properly with shackles, ensuring they are fitted tightly and correctly to prevent any slippage during recovery or transit. It’s also important to match the appropriate shackle size and type to the vehicle and load being recovered.
